Description
Technical field
The utility model is related to a kind of power equipment, i.e., a kind of transformer loading and unloading bracket.
Background technology
The installation and dismounting of distribution transformer are the important operations that electric power facility is safeguarded, at present, this operation is mainly by two
The instrument of kind, one kind is crane, and another kind is artificial jack.Crane is limited by working space and limited with safe distance, sometimes not
Can use.Artificial jack need to become platform peri position colligation slinging beam, there is electric shock risk, and lifting speed is very low, and efficiency is low
Under, the activity duration is long.

Specific embodiment
As shown in Figure 1 and Figure 2, this transformer loading and unloading bracket 1, including the three-dimensional bracket 1 being made up of column 2 and crossbeam 3,
Here three-dimensional bracket 1 is to constitute cubical framework, including cuboid framework.Can also lower go up small trapezoidal or centrum greatly
Framework.It is characterized in:End slipway 4 is provided with along both sides above the support, end slipway 4 is provided with longitudinal coaster 5 above, longitudinal direction
Coaster 5 is provided with transverse slipway 6, and transverse direction coaster 7 is equipped with transverse slipway 6, and horizontal coaster 7 is fitted with hoist engine 8.Obviously, roll up
Raising machine 8 can change position along end slipway 4 and transverse slipway 6, reach any position below end slipway.
When installing transformer with this support, first that support 1 is mounted in place, hoist engine 8 is along the He of end slipway 4
The adjustment position of transverse slipway 6, the vehicle for transporting transformer is preferably able to enter the lower section of support 1, transformer 10 and the phase of hoist engine 8
It is right.Transformer 10 is fettered with hoist cable 9 again, hoist engine 8 is started, you can transformer 10 is sling, required height is reached
It is installed on change platform.
On the basis of the above, can further improve:The middle part both sides of the support 1 are provided with dismountable support beam 12,
Two rail 11 are fitted with above.Rail 11 is the combiner that can be loaded and unloaded at any time, can at any time install or unload, can be in branch
Slide and change position on support beam 12, two distances of rail 11 can change.The length of rail 11 is greater than the length of support 1
Degree, the one end of rail 11 preferably has the pintle hook lock 17 that can be fixedly connected with support beam 12.The form of pintle hook lock 17 is a lot, is only enumerated in figure
A kind of pintle hook lock 17 of U-bolt formula, can be fixedly connected rail with support beam by connecting plate with nut.
When operation starts, the vehicle for the ease of transporting transformer will enter support 1, should take out lower rail 11.Work as transformation
Device 10 is sling, and after transport vehicle is sailed out of, two rail 11 can be put into above support beam 12 as shown in Figure 1 and Figure 2.Work as change
After the lifting of depressor 10 is higher than change platform, it is possible to as shown in Figure 3, Figure 4, two rail 11 are slided into below transformer 10,
Preferably one end of rail is pulled out to platform direction is become, is allowed to close to change platform.Utilize pintle hook lock 17 rail away from the one of change platform simultaneously
End is fixed in support beam 12.In this manner it is possible to transformer 10 is shifted onto above change platform along rail 11.
When transformer is dismantled, the above-mentioned way of backward reference, it is possible to smoothly complete dismounting operation.
In order to further optimize the performance of equipment, supporting plate 14 can be set in the lower end of hoist cable 9, be provided with below supporting plate 14
Roller 15.When lifting transformer 10, supporting plate 14 is placed under transformer, and lifting can be made more steady, mitigates hoist cable to becoming
The abrasion of depressor housing.When transformer 10 is fallen above rail, roller 15 is contacted with rail, is slided very laborsaving.
In order to adapt to the demand of different height, the bottom of column 2 of support 1 is preferably provided with heightens sleeve pipe 13, can adjust branch
The height of frame.The lower end of pillar 12 is preferably equipped with land wheel 16, and land wheel 16 is preferably universal wheel, in order to movement.
The power of above-mentioned hoist engine can be electronic, or gasoline engine or diesel engine, it would however also be possible to employ hydraulic means
Lifted by crane.
